Transaction 5c52954c56403984cb5a0e48e9e2aead63f6eb990c7d7550ee5fad2cbaf7d23d

3 Input
2 Outputs
  • 5c52954c56403984cb5a0e48e9e2aead63f6eb990c7d7550ee5fad2cbaf7d23d:0
  • value  20354683
    address  3BMEXfCmMpd6AKi9VE5fz4pYpFabDfZEqD
  • 5c52954c56403984cb5a0e48e9e2aead63f6eb990c7d7550ee5fad2cbaf7d23d:1
  • value  61448317
    address  12iLqtianYB5ZgKLC1522iJqouEHtiwFAe